NEIGHBORHOOD WATCH: Pretty couples and their pretty bikes

POSTED: Wednesday, November 18, 2009, 8:28 PM

In this column's past, Critical Mass immersed itself in one neighborhood each week and found its most stylish inhabitants. We're switching things up. Now, this will be a space for us to find fashionable folk all across the city. But we're still keeping the hood theme ' kinda, sorta ' by asking our subjects where they're from and therefore trying to glean which trends are specific to which neighborhoods.

I'm likin' those love eyes, playa.

Both from South Philly, Nashia T. (33) and Dustin K. (27) mostly shop at the Old City boutique Lost+Found. She also recommends Etsy for good finds, though she doesn't always stick with handmade goods and vintage. "I do shop at Urban,' says Nashia. 'I am guilty of that.' He's honest, too. "She bought my this shirt," says Dustin.

Photos | Nicole Saylor

Hadji J. (22) emulates '40s styles, reasoning that it was a time when everyone looked good ' or at least they always did in the movies. 'People used to dress up ' not just for a special occasion,' says Hadji.

Photos | Nicole Saylor

Laura J. (18), a North Philly student, turns to Keira Knightley for fashion inspiration. 'Sometimes she'll dress really casual,' says Laura. 'And then I love her dresses.'

Photos | Nicole Saylor

Sarah W. (20), a Lower Merion resident, looks to model Erin Wasson for street style tips. 'She collaborates inspirations from different cities,' says Sarah.

Photos | Nicole Saylor

Amber Lynn T. (28) lives in Fishtown, but makes her living in Northern Liberties as the owner of art gallery/boutique Amberella. She sees fashion as a game. 'I like dressing up in different costumes,' she says.
